How to get recommended for a secondment?
The local committees of beneficiary institutions select, approve, and recommend secondments. Staff members have to discuss their plans with their Scientific Contact. When the Scientific Contact deems the proposal valuable, the staff member fills in an application form. The Local Scientific Contact will have to recommend, and the Project Coordinator will have to approve the proposal for a secondment.
